Overstated and Misunderstood Cuts
- Doge announced large federal spending cuts, but investigations often revealed minimal or no actual cuts.
- Some data like Social Security ages were misunderstood, causing exaggerated claims of fraud savings.
Questionable Doge Staff Hires
- Musk's Doge people included questionable hires with hacker and racist backgrounds.
- This raises concerns about data privacy and misuse of sensitive government information.
Risk of Data Misuse and Fast Failures
- Doge used Musk's AI Grok for data analysis, raising fears of private data misuse.
- Government's "move fast and break things" approach can harm vulnerable people relying on services.
